跨国网络部署实战,如何在外国服务器上搭建安全高效的VPN服务

dfbn6 2026-04-25 半仙VPN 4 0

随着全球化办公和远程访问需求的不断增长,越来越多的企业和个人开始关注如何通过虚拟私人网络(VPN)实现跨地域的安全连接,尤其对于需要访问境外资源、规避网络限制或提升远程协作效率的用户而言,在外国服务器上搭建自己的VPN服务成为一种既灵活又可控的选择,本文将从技术原理出发,详细讲解如何在海外云服务商(如AWS、Google Cloud或DigitalOcean)部署一个稳定、安全且合规的自建VPN服务。

明确目标:我们希望在位于美国、欧洲或亚洲的云服务器上搭建一个支持多设备接入、加密传输、低延迟的OpenVPN或WireGuard服务,OpenVPN因成熟稳定、配置灵活而被广泛采用;WireGuard则以轻量高效著称,适合移动设备和高并发场景,选择哪个协议取决于你的性能要求和使用习惯。

第一步是准备服务器环境,登录你选择的云平台(如Amazon EC2),创建一台Ubuntu 20.04 LTS或CentOS Stream 8的实例,确保防火墙开放UDP端口(OpenVPN默认1194,WireGuard默认51820),并绑定公网IP,建议启用SSH密钥登录而非密码,提高安全性。

第二步是安装与配置VPN服务,以OpenVPN为例,使用命令行工具安装OpenVPN软件包:

sudo apt update && sudo apt install openvpn easy-rsa -y

然后初始化证书颁发机构(CA),生成服务器和客户端证书,这一步至关重要,因为所有通信都依赖于这些数字证书进行身份验证,完成后,编辑/etc/openvpn/server.conf文件,指定本地网段(如10.8.0.0/24)、DNS服务器(推荐使用Google DNS 8.8.8.8)、压缩选项等,最后启动服务:

sudo systemctl enable openvpn@server
sudo systemctl start openvpn@server

第三步是客户端配置,将生成的客户端配置文件(包含证书、密钥和服务器地址)分发给用户,Windows、macOS、Android和iOS均有官方客户端支持,用户只需导入配置文件即可一键连接,无需额外设置。

务必考虑日志审计、访问控制和带宽管理,可借助fail2ban防止暴力破解,利用iptables设置QoS规则保障关键业务流量优先级,定期更新系统补丁和OpenVPN版本,防范已知漏洞(如CVE-2023-XXX类漏洞)。

最后提醒:虽然技术可行,但需遵守当地法律法规,某些国家对未备案的VPN服务有严格限制,若用于商业用途,应咨询法律顾问并办理相应资质,合法合规是长期运营的前提。

在外国服务器上搭建自用VPN是一项融合了网络工程、信息安全和法律意识的综合实践,它不仅提升了数据隐私保护能力,也为全球协作提供了可靠的技术底座,掌握这一技能,意味着你真正拥有了“数字主权”的一部分。

跨国网络部署实战,如何在外国服务器上搭建安全高效的VPN服务

VPN加速器|半仙VPN加速器-免费VPN梯子首选半仙VPN